Home
Movies
TV Shows
People
Trending
Settings
Scroll to top
Barbara D'Alterio
London, England, UK
Barbara D'Alterio is an English actress with Italian heritage.
Known for
Credits
Images
10.0
I Think My Dad's a Cyborg and I Think He Killed My Mum
—
Barbara D'Alterio - WatchtopiaX